Online Advertising

CNN - Apr 16th, 2025
Score 6.8

Google faces $6.6 billion lawsuit in Britain for alleged abuse of dominance in online search

Google faces £5B UK lawsuit over search dominance abuse claims

Previous Next

Showing 1 to 1 of 1 results